OPR - Delayed Quote USD

VST May 2025 148.000 put (VST250530P00148000)

0.0100
-0.1800
(-94.74%)
As of May 30 at 3:49:26 PM EDT. Market Open.
Currency in USD
Download
Date Open High Low Close Adj Close Volume
May 30, 20250.04000.04000.01000.01000.01006
May 29, 20250.19000.19000.19000.19000.19007
May 28, 20250.19000.28000.18000.28000.280026
May 27, 20250.67000.67000.26000.30000.300022
May 23, 20251.52001.52001.12001.13001.1300225
May 22, 20254.03004.03002.31002.31002.31004
May 21, 20252.68003.56002.68003.43003.43004
May 19, 20252.75002.75002.56002.56002.560040
May 16, 20253.65003.65003.65003.65003.65002
May 15, 20254.60004.70004.10004.70004.70008
May 14, 20254.90004.90004.37004.37004.37009
May 13, 20254.80004.80003.70003.70003.70004